Course Content

• Good Agricultural Practices (GAP) and Good Hygiene Practices (GHP) for Cambodian Food Production
•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points (HACCP) Principles and Application in Cambodian Food Businesses
• Cambodian Food Safety Regulations and Compliance
• Foodborne Illness Prevention and Control: Microbiological Safety
• Chemical Hazards in Food and their Control in the Cambodian Context
• Food Packaging and Labeling Regulations in Cambodia
• Food Safety Management Systems (FSMS) Implementation and Auditing
• Pest Control and Sanitation in Cambodian Food Processing Facilities
• Cambodia's Food Safety Authority and its Role in the Industry
